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Lee Station to Awbridge is to drive which costs £20 - £30 and takes 1h 58m.
The fastest way to get from Lee Station to Awbridge is to drive which takes 1h 58m and costs £20 - £30.
No, there is no direct train from Lee Station to Awbridge. However, there are services departing from Lee and arriving at Mottisfont & Dunbridge via London Waterloo and Salisbury.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 19m.
The distance between Lee Station and Awbridge is 104 miles. The road distance is 83.8 miles.
The best way to get from Lee Station to Awbridge without a car is to train via Salisbury which takes 3h 19m and costs £29 - £80.
It takes approximately 3h 19m to get from Lee Station to Awbridge, including transfers.
Lee Station to Awbridge train services, operated by South Western Railway, depart from London Waterloo station.
The best way to get from Lee Station to Awbridge is to train via Salisbury which takes 3h 19m and costs £29 - £80. Alternatively, you can line 185 bus and bus, which costs £19 - £70 and takes 5h 36m.
Lee Station to Awbridge train services, operated by South Western Railway, arrive at Salisbury station.
Yes, the driving distance between Lee Station to Awbridge is 84 miles. It takes approximately 1h 58m to drive from Lee Station to Awbridge.
